What’s the highest charting song of Justin Timberlake?

Indie rock band Imagine Dragons has three singles on the list, one of them being ” Radioactive “, their highest-charting single on the list. Justin Timberlake has three singles in the Top 25, two of which are his own songs, with ” Mirrors ” at number 6 and ” Suit & Tie ” at number 20.

What was the second best selling song of 2013?

The second best-selling single of 2013 was ” Blurred Lines ” by Robin Thicke featuring T.I. and Pharrell, having sold 6,380,000 copies in the country. Meanwhile, ” Radioactive ” by Imagine Dragons and ” Harlem Shake ” by Baauer was listed on the list at number three and four, respectively.

What was the number one song on the Billboard Hot 100 in 2016?

” Love Yourself ” by Justin Bieber came in at number one, spending a total of two nonconsecutive weeks at the top position of the Billboard Hot 100 during 2016. ” Sorry “, which also topped the weekly chart, is ranked at number two on the year-end list.

How many songs were on the Billboard Hot 100 in 2013?

This is a list of singles that charted in the top ten of the Billboard Hot 100, an all-genre singles chart, in 2013. During the year, 62 songs and 59 acts charted in the tier, and 34 of these acts scored their first top-ten single in the US either as a lead or featured artist.

What was the number one hit in 2013?

Drake scored the most top ten hits in 2013 with four, including ” Fuckin’ Problems “, ” Started from the Bottom “, ” Love Me ” and ” Hold On, We’re Going Home “. Lorde ‘s ” Royals ” was the longest running top 10 single in 2013, spending 23 weeks in the top 10.
